CryptoLase exhibits multiple hallmark signs of a likely crypto investment scam, including unverifiable claims of AI-powered trading and regulation, aggressive income promises, and extremely recent domain creation with high-risk offshore hosting. The page solicits personal data for registration and presents itself as both regulated and trustworthy without supporting evidence.
Why We Think This Is A Scam
Domain created about 3 hours ago while presenting as an established, regulated financial service ('holding a licence', 'regulated in partnership')
Hosted by Offshore Racks S.A in Panama, a common location for high-abuse/offshore operations
Aggressive income claims: 'earn above-average income' with AI-powered trading
Claims 'Bank-Level Security', 'Advanced AI Algorithms', 'Expert Investment Management', and official regulation, without providing company registration, jurisdiction, or license numbers
Heavy solicitation of personal details (first name, last name, email, phone) via POST forms on a freshly registered domain
Claims of trust and partnership ('They trust us', 'Financial services provider regulated in partnership') without evidence or named partners
No external verifiable domains or third-party validation; all content self-referential
